Let It Snow The alarm clock goes off signifying another day of school, but one quick look outside contradicts this usual pattern. Snow had fallen continuously throughout the night making the roads icy and hazardous. The radio broadcasts that there is no school in Newport News. Believe it or not, this became something of a pattern for the winter of '7 8. Because of snow and ice storms there was no school for three days and school was dismissed early several days during the winter. This did not cause too much distress for it allowed students to catch up on that much needed beauty sleep. Many trips were made to ski resorts by several groups of students. Those who had never before experienced the won- ders of sking ended up bruised, sore and with broken bones. But this did not hamper their spirits for they were more than willing to go back again next year. By the end of the winter everyone was relieved when spring finally arrived. For everybody loves snow, but a person gets tired of it when it hangs around for a while. Therefore spring was welcomed with open arms for it not only marked the end of winter but meant that summer was just around the corner. Juniors Receive Rings Shaking with cold, nerves and excite- ment, Juniors crept into the cafeteria in suits and formals on December 10; a night they will long remember. Music by Slap- water set the mood for Ring Dance, and the theme, A Place in the Sun. As always, the highlight of the evening was receiving rings, under the ring, sealing it with a kiss, then rushing around to have it turned 77 times. Refreshments were served by members of the Senior class who ingeniously cut the cake into a 78, which an irate Junior changed into a 79. As midnight drew near, the class knew that a year and a half of hard work, car washes, and doughnut sales had paid off. Souvenir tickets were collected at the door at the end of the dance to lock the memory of Ring Dance ‘17 in mind. TOP: The excitement of Ring Dance catches the band, SLAPWATER as they play.
